It’s been a little while since I heard about the absolutely fantastic sounding horror slasher MURDER LOVES KILLERS TOO (see The Pub’s outstanding review here). I personally can’t wait to see this baby (pretty nice poster for it up top, huh?) and if I happen to be in Malaga, Spain on November 8th or 11th, I will indeed check it out on the big screen!

What the hell?! You may be saying and rightfully so. Here’s your clarification: MLKT just scored a spot at the 18th edition of FANCINE in Spain. Yes, I’ve never heard of it either, but obviously it’s some sort of film festival. So, congratulations to writer/director Drew Barnhardt!

In case you weren’t already aware, here is MLKT’s plot: Big Stevie has a sexual problem. Murder is how he has sex. And Big Stevie knows that there is no better way for a repressed killer to blow off steam than killing a bunch of care-free free-spirited teens. After her friends are all chopped, carved, and slashed, sweet young Aggie is left alone to face off against this unreasonable psycho. Now she’s got a pervert on her hands. A big one. And Big Stevie’s problem could become Aggie’s problem real fast.

How can you beat that?! And if that ain’t enough to stir your interest, then I must remind you of the flick’s scream queen stars up top, below and here. Just outstanding! I don’t know when MLKT will be releasing in the U.S., but for now you can check out the trailer at its official site here.
